verndað
Verndað is an Icelandic adjective meaning protected or safeguarded. It is the past passive participle of the verb vernda, and it is used to describe something that is under protection, whether by law, policy, or ethical obligation. The form is used attributively or predicatively and agrees with the noun it modifies in gender and number.
